**09:05** — The Quillmont invoice renderer began emitting blank PDFs for invoices containing plugin-injected line items. Cause: a font subsetting change dropped glyphs that third-party plugins referenced. Plugin authors were not at fault; the host renderer broke the embedding contract. A hotfix restored full font embedding by 10:12. The fix ships in the build identified below.

trace token, kawip-fafog: htk14_26e64c4d35154e

All integrations with the Cardelia build service must follow our dependency pinning policy: every package is pinned to an exact version in the manifest, and transitive dependencies are locked via the generated lockfile committed alongside it. Floating ranges are rejected at submission time, and the resolver verifies checksums against our internal mirror, Quarrystone. Requests to the policy-check endpoint must be authenticated; reviewers querying pin compliance reports should use the service key provided below.

gateway credential: kto23_LX9A4ys6i4nzHtpOLNLodKK

Subject: Token refresh weirdness — handover

Hey Mira,

Passing the session-token refresh bug over to you before I'm out. Short version: Quillbase occasionally refreshes tokens twice when a plugin calls the auth hook inside a transaction, so plugin authors see random 401s. I've added extra logging on the refresh path, but haven't found the race yet. Repro steps are in the shared notes. Plugin folks will want the staging sandbox to poke at it themselves — connect using the string below.

replica DSN, kajep-yahag: mssql://praok_svc:iF@db-8d68.plorvaio.local:5432/eliion

The garage occupancy feed for the Brindlewood campus arrives over a message queue every thirty seconds, one record per level, published by the Stallgrid edge boxes. Counts can briefly go negative when a sensor double-fires on exit; the ingest job clamps these to zero and flags the interval. If the feed stalls for more than five minutes, the dashboard falls back to the last known snapshot. Sensor mappings, queue names, and the replay procedure are documented on the internal page below.

runbook for tahog-kadug: https://gitlab.qirvanworks.corp/projects/pages/view/b139298aed28